10) LED_CPU (CPU Cooler LED Strip/RGB LED Strip Header)
The header can be used to connect a CPU cooler LED strip or a standard 5050 RGB LED strip (12V/G/R/B),
with maximum power rating of 2A (12V) and maximum length of 2m.

11) F_AUDIO (Front Panel Audio Header)
The ront panel audio header supports High Denition audio (HD). You may connect your chassis ront
panel audio module to this header. Make sure the wire assignments of the module connector match the
pin assignments of the motherboard header. Incorrect connection between the module connector and the
motherboard header will make the device unable to work or even damage it.

Connect the CPU cooler LED strip/RGB LED strip to the
header. The power pin (marked with a triangle on the plug)
o the LED strip must be connected to Pin 1 (12V) o this
header. Incorrect connection may lead to the damage of the
LED strip.
